WebThrombocytopenia is when there’s a low number of platelets, also known as thrombocytes, in the blood. Normally, there are between 150,000 and 450,000 thrombocytes per microliter of blood; while in thrombocytopenia, this number goes below 150,000 cells per microliter. WebAnemia in Newborns. Anemia in newborns is a condition where the baby’s body has a lower red blood cell count than normal.
